Jerika, the other day I used a chop stick to stir a body butter and then used it diagonally at the pour spout on the exact Pyrex measuring cup. Holding the chopstick with a bit sticking down longer than the spout and it gave me excellent stability using both hands to steady the container and it ran down in a nice smaller linear flow that I could direct more precisely into the hole, and it made it faster to fill them and I had way less drips almost none and since it came out faster I had fluid easy pour with hardly any that hardened up and stuck to everything else. Your over thinking the transition from loaves to slab. All you need to do is determine the amount of soap your slab makes then "resize" it in the soap calculator. The vendor your purchasing the slab mold should give the capacity (lbs). You'll likely need a very large stainless steel stock pot for your soap batter, larger spatulas and spoons. You will want to be sure your stick blender has a longer 19" shaft to accommodate the larger batch. Much easier that you think - you've got this!!!! ❤
